TACBeam - Amphenol Fiber Systems International (AFSI)
The TACBeam® is a MIL-PRF-83526/20 & /21 qualified expanded beam rugged fiber optic connector for military and industrial applications. TACBeam® is hermaphroditic, which allows multiple cable assemblies to connect together to support varying distance requirements. D38999 Series III TV-CTV - 38999 Series | Amphenol Socapex
The38999 series III connectors are designed for use in harsh military and industrial environments. This series offers a wide range of contact arrangements and shell types, making it an ideal choice for applications that require maximum weight and space savings.
